3. Double-click on the Ports (COM & LPT) icon.
4. Double-click on the name of the port you want to configure.
You can now view or change information about your serial port in the
following ways:
To view the hardware resources assigned to the serial port, click on the
Resources tab.
To view or change the port settings, click on the Port Settings tab.
For more information about the settings, refer to the next section, Port
Settings Tab.
To change the RS-485 transceiver mode, or to enable or disable the
FIFOs on the serial hardware, in the Port Settings tab, click on the
Advanced button. For more information about the settings, refer to the
next section, Port Settings Tab.
Note
If you use two-wire TXRDY mode, FIFOs must be enabled. Transceiver modes
apply to RS-485 interfaces only. For more information about transceiver modes, refer to
Chapter 6, Using Your Serial Hardware.
5. To save your changes, click on the OK button. To exit without saving
the changes, click on the Cancel button.
